The world’s leading research and advisory firm Gartner reveals that more than 30% of the global customer base will be comprised of products that use blockchain technology as an operational technology so as to carry out all commercial operations.

Gaming, art, automotive,tourism, renewable energy, agrifood, logistics & transport, and others are some of the industries already using blockchain in their daily activities. Many European countries such as Italy, for example, explore the tech in order to optimise their business industry.

Microsoft and Google have already a BaaS, Microsoft is one of the leading company with Deloitte and IBM. Amazon is brand new with it. But yeah I agree, the major players in the technology industry will surely have the monopoly

Their products target companies for their own use, to create private blockchains. Why a company should care about "decentralization" while its goal is something totally different and the blockchain is 'private'.
An example, Insurances could use smart contracts for a blockchain-based automation protocol. Do they have an advantage with decentralization?
